Ingredients
For the Chicken and Noodles
- 400g chicken breast, sliced
- 250g egg noodles
- 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on ginger, minced
- 3 tablespoons soy sauce
- 2 tablespoons honey
- 1 tablespoon rice vinegar
- 1 tablespoon sesame oil
- 2 green onions, chopped
Mix the ingredients well and prepare for cooking!
Instructions
Cook the Noodles
In a large pot of boiling salted water, cook the egg noodles according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
Prepare the Chicken
In a large skillet, heat the vegetable oil over medium-high heat. Add the sliced chicken and cook until browned and cooked through, about 5-7 minutes.
Make the Sauce
Add the minced garlic and ginger to the skillet with the chicken, cooking for an additional 1-2 minutes until fragrant. Stir in the soy sauce, honey, rice vinegar, and sesame oil, mixing well to combine.
Combine and Serve
Add the cooked noodles to the skillet, tossing to coat in the sauce. Cook for another 2-3 minutes until heated through. Garnish with chopped green onions before serving.

Cooking Tips for Success
To ensure your Sticky Garlic Chicken Noodles is perfectly executed, be mindful of the cooking times. Overcooked chicken can become dry, so keep an eye on it as it browns. Cooking it in batches can also help maintain the heat in the skillet, leading to a better sear and more flavor.
Don’t skimp on the garnishes! Fresh green onions not only enhance the presentation but also add a punch of flavor. A sprinkle of sesame seeds can also elevate the dish, providing a delightful crunch and visual appeal.
Questions About Recipes
→ Can I use other types of noodles?
Yes, you can substitute egg noodles with rice noodles or any other type of noodle you prefer.
→ How do I store leftovers?
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
→ Can I make this dish gluten-free?
Yes, use gluten-free soy sauce and noodles to make this dish gluten-free.
→ How can I add more vegetables?
You can add bell peppers, broccoli, or snap peas to the dish for added nutrition and flavor.
